Regretted  Death ;

The death occurred  of  Eileen McManus (nee Hand), late of ( Corrygarry Kingscourt)  peacefully  at Castleross Nursing Home, Carrickmacross and formerly of Stranatona, Magheracloone.  Predeceased by her husband Peter, they lived for a time in Corduffkelly, Carrickmacross, in the early sixties they built a house on Corrygarry, Kingscourt. She was an enthusiastic cyclist and loved the great outdoors, for the past few years she was a resident in Castleross Nursing Home, Carrickmacross. She is survived by her sisters; May Sheridan , Kingscourt and Rose Breen, Carrickmacross, brother ; Jim Hand, Auckland, New Zealand, nieces, nephews relatives and friends to whom sympathy is extended. Requiem funeral Mass on  Tuesday 28 th. January, in the Church of the Immaculate Conception with  Cremation  afterwards in Glasnevin  Crematorium

Grandparents Day;

On Thursday of last week, over 200 school children  and grandparents, attended a special Mass in the Church of the Immaculate Conception, which was celebrated by Rev. Fr. Joe White, for grandparents .  Grandparents also attended a prayer service in St. Joseph’s N/S  school, the pupils made buns and cake which they gave to the grandparents along with a cup of tea and coffee.
